
- Put on gloves and a long-sleeved shirt. Cut aluminum often has sharp edges, so protective gear is necessary.
- Climb a ladder to the roof. Make the repairs from the ladder if possible. ...
- Cut around the edges of the hole to make them straight instead of jagged using tin snips. Measure the size of the new hole.
- Cut a piece of replacement aluminum with tin snips to 3 inches longer on all sides than the hole. ...
- Follow the inside of the marked area around the hole with butyl tape. Add two rows of tape, or enough rows to make the taped area 2 inches wide.
- Place the patch on top of the butyl tape. Drive aluminum screws every 2 inches around the perimeter of the patch with a power screwdriver.
- Apply roofing caulk around the seams of the patch and over the screws. Allow the caulk to dry.
- Paint aluminum roof coating over the patch with a paintbrush, overlapping the seams by at least 2 inches.

How do I fix my aluminum awning?
Wash the leaking area and after it dries, apply a line of polyether sealant to cracks or gaps in the awning. Use a sealant that is UV resistant, exterior grade and designed for seams and metal. The sealant will fill the crack as it dries and plug the leak.
How do I stop my patio roof from leaking?
Fill a caulking gun with a watertight polyurethane or oil-based sealant and hold it at an angle to insert the product directly into the gap. For a gap of 1 inch or less, caulking or sealant is the best method of repair.

Why is my aluminum pan roof damaged?
Your aluminum pan roof can be damaged by wind uptake, expanding winter ice conditions or the nesting of wild animals. Any of those situations can cause the roof panels to pull away from the flashing, which channels rainwater into the surfaces below.
Can aluminum pan roofs be leaking?
A modern aluminum pan roof can provide many years of maintenance-free service, but older roofing may eventually show signs of leaking or corrosion. In addition, exposure to years of direct sunlight can fade or damage painted finishes and lead to unsightly peeling or flaking.
Can metal roofing be corroded?
Metal Corrosion. If the roof was installed using old-fashioned lead washers or non-galvanized nails or screws, those fasteners will corrode over time and that corrosion may spread beyond the initial hole. If that's the case, you should plan on replacing the original fasteners to prevent widespread corrosion.
